this is about some of the stuff that i think about a lot. the body is so limited, nothing more than a pile of organized cells, functioning because of chemical reactions, driven by the senseless goal of keeping itself alive and reproducing. the mind is just a product of that body, it's tied to those unreliable senses (maybe other people don't go into an existencial crisis because of some optical illusions.. i tend to do sometimes). when trying to grasp concepts of space and time and all the freaky stuff, this weak little arsenal of cells is all we can rely on. it's our reality, sure.. but it seems so insignificant. just look at that little mind, trying to figure out the concept of the self, like a dog chasing its tail.. and just as pathetic.
of course this picture isn't quite as detailed as those thoughts that i tried to outline.. i threw in some more or less generic organic textures.. and the tapir is obviously the seemingly pure little mind, trying to escape the organic world that it depends on.
filed under "macabre and horror" because those are really horrifying thoughts for me.
